Trump arrives in a bad mood for NATO summit, which will be held in a "tense atmosphere" - CNN Donald Trump's dissatisfaction with European allies' refusal to support the United States during the war in the Middle East is creating a tense atmosphere at the summit in Ankara. The US president is traveling to the summit only because the event is being held in the capital of Turkey, whose President, Recep Tayyip Erdogan, Trump considers a friend. A CNN source said that Trump and his team were privately made to understand that refusing to attend the summit would be disrespectful to Erdogan. European leaders are hoping to hold the meeting in Ankara without a major explosion, announcing new defense commitments to calm Trump's anger. But in private conversations last week, many officials said they were unsure whether the summit would go smoothly, given the president's bad mood. NATO Secretary-General Mark Rutte used flattery tactics with Trump at last year's NATO summit, and it mostly worked. European officials are eager to repeat the same scenario in Ankara, but for many such an outcome seems unattainable. What is this event about?
This market will resolve to "Yes" if Donald Trump attends the NATO Summit event scheduled for July 7, 2026 – July 8, 2026
in Ankara, Türkiye. Otherwise, this market will resolve to "No".
If the event is canceled or postponed beyond August 30, 2026, 11:59 PM ET, this market will resolve to "No".
Attending the NATO Summit is defined as being in physical attendance in the event at any point between the start and end of the Summit.
The resolution source will be a consensus of credible reporting.
